Title
Optimization of WDM multihop logical topologies

Abstract
Due to high installation and maintenance costs of optical WDM (wavelength division multiplexing) networks will be deployed with some optimization criteria in mind. Here we study the problem of designing the logical topology and routing of traffic, with the objective to minimize congestion while constraining the average delay seen by a source-destination pair and number of wavelengths used, for a given network physical topology and traffic pattern. The adopted method divides the problem into two parts: the logical topology design, implemented using heuristic algorithms, and traffic routing, formulated as a linear programming problem. We suggest that an aggregated formulation should be used for the traffic problem and that post-optimal analysis can be used to keep the traffic optimised on the network
